lipothymy

/laɪəˈθaɪmi/

Definitions

1. noun

a sudden attack of faintness or dizziness, often caused by a sudden shock, fright, or emotional disturbance.

“The patient experienced a bout of lipothymy after hearing the news of her grandmother’s passing.”
